WebMar 23, 2024 · A Roth IRA is a retirement savings vehicle that you fund with after-tax dollars. Roth IRA contributions don’t get you a tax deduction. ... You generally have 10 years from the death of the original owner to cash out all of the assets within the inherited IRA. WebIn most cases, non-spousal beneficiaries inheriting a Roth IRA will not be subject to annual RMDs but will instead be required to withdraw all assets from the Roth IRA before December 31 of the tenth year following the Roth IRA owner’s death. These withdrawals will be tax-free. Who Should Consider Converting
